CD key in use is different from a global ban. What does happen sometimes, is that people buy CD-Keys in bulk (say from a website store) using stolen credit card details, and then resell them on their own store/ebay/etc.... When the card correctly gets identified as fraudulent, the keys get removed and those who bought the key find they can no longer use it. Where did you buy a game from? -

Fact: DayZ Loads many, many, many more objects into a mission than a normal ArmA2 mission. Fact: Most of these objects occur AFTER the mission is loaded, very little is preloaded as part of the mission loading sequence. Fact: This has caused NaN results for verticies in instances of certain objects, that were binarized in a different way. When the verticies went to NaN they stretch as far as allowed in the engine (50m max size for an object). Fact: A change in the way ArmA2 rendered made NaN happen with these objects, due to a graphical optimization. Floating point precision was lost in complex scenes, causing the issue. Fact: This has been fixed for the dead bodies. Fact: It is possible, but much less likely, that this occurs for Wire Obstacles.

This topic is for information of the status of the next update. Affected Addons: * dayz * dayz_code * dayz_server (server) Target date: * Thursday 6 September 2012 (GMT) Confirmed Changelog (WIP): * [NEW] Bear trap has chance to spawn on infected hunters * [FIXED] Graphical glitches with dead bodies (Bodies should now not display graphical glitches) * [NEW] Three UI options available: Default (indicators only), Debug (indicators + debug window), None (only base ArmA2 UI) * [FIXED] Tents and vehicles not saving correctly ( https://dev-heaven.net/issues/41502 ) * [FIXED] Converting between magazine types resets ammo count (Now only contains previous number of rounds) In Process Changelog (WIP): * [NEW] Option to flip vehicles that have rolled
